Saving the media. Capitalism, crowdfunding, and democracy

Series
Reuters Institute for the Study of Journalism
Audio Embed
Julia Cage, assistant professor of economics, Sciences Po Paris, Department of Economics, gives a talk for the The Business and Practice of Journalism seminar series.
